\"the dicey weather makes us all seriously consider global warming\"

And yesterday I had a job interview where they made me sit down and talk to six different people at this tiny school. It was overwhelming but understandable; if they want you, they will make the most informed choice possible.

After the four hour "visit", my corners creased, I drank too much coffee and listened to my possible coworkers discuss the fires.

Big Sur is on fire. Big Sur.

"There were thunderstorms up and down southern California last weekend. Started so many fires."

I creased my eyebrows together but didn't say anything. I just thought about how I was in northern California last weekend, northern, and there were thunderstorms there, too.

You do realize how large this state is, don't you? Some of its inhabitants have argued for decades to cut it right in half, like Virginia. Now all of it is on fire.
